Big day today, Melly and I do a little work on Barney to mock up a Hot Wings Glass Flat Tracker-1 tail section and fender combo onto Barney. The little Honda Rebel 250 is going to get styled after a street tracker. Lots of plans in the works for Barney, but today was all about getting the look & stance right.
Still need to adjust the tank and fender till it's perfect. Then we will need to make up brackets to mount it all. I also have to decide on a 110V Mig Welder that will do a good job. Fun times in the garage!

    Currently they are Biker Master 7/8" European "Tracker Bars". We recently purchased 7/8 Biltwell Tracker bars as they have the cross brace and a pad. In reality, just about any 7/8" handlebar will work as long as the brake and clutch cables are long enough. The wiring and throttle will work fine. On the 80's era Honda Rebels the handle bars are a bit longer than the newer Rebel 250's so there is plenty of extra slack. Cheers!
